Lendang Nangka (also known as Pringgayudha) is historical village in East Lombok of West Nusa Tenggara, Indonesia. This village is rich in terms of culture, nature resources, and art and dance.

Understand edit

The village is located in the district of Masbagik in East Lombok regency, about 40 km east of the provincial capital Mataram.

Taxi fares are quite reasonable if they use the meter. Some drivers may try and enforce a Rp 20,000 minimum. Taxi is equipped with meters which should be used by their drivers at all times. Flag fall is approximately Rp 6,000 and the meter ticks up a few hundred rupiah for every hundred meters past 2 km. Taxis can be booked in advance either by calling them yourself. By ojek

Prices are negotiable but a rule of thumb is Rp 10,000-15,000 for a short trip with a local motorbike rider if the destination is nearby, longer distances will require some informed negotiation. By horsecart

Horse carts known as cidomo remain a common means of transport in Lendang Nangka and they are often found operating throughout the congested streets near a pasar or mosques of Lendang Nangka. By car

Renting a car is a possible alternative in Lendang Nangka. It will cost around Rp 300,000-Rp 500,000 for a Toyota Avanza/Daihatsu Xenia (2x4) 6-8 seats, Rp 300,000- Rp 450,000 for a Toyota Kijang (2x4) with 7-8 seats. Age and condition of car will effect price as will high rental demand. Commonly the renting includes a trained-English speaking driver. Motorbikes are also available for rent around Lendang Nangka. Expect to pay approximately Rp 50,000 per day for a motor bike in as new condition.

Lendang Nangka has many natural tourism objects to see and enjoy, i.e. spring, eco tourism, water fall, terraced ricefield, garden, monkey forest, kettle market, traditional market, silver smith, black smith. This village guesthouse offers visitors an opportunity for a cultural and social immersion experience in a contemporary local Sasak kampung.The facilities are modest but sufficient and the hospitality is genuine and un-pretentious including home cooked meals and the opportunity to meet and interact with a local community in the Lendang Nangka area. Trips to local rice fields, coffee, cocao, banana, coconut, and clove plantations can be arranged as well as the more predictable touristic sites. The hosts are heavily involved in local community based agricultural training and development programs and also offer opportunities for direct involvement in volunteer and community development programs if visitors are interested. People can just use the guesthhouse if they require but the house' stand out feature is the opportunity to see more of the local community than most visitors normally do. If required a car or motorbike can be arranged for transport to the location. Singles and small groups are welcome. For more adventurous guests trips and overnight stays can be provided to a nearby tradition mountain village, access is by motor bike and conditions are more basic, but still very welcoming. 1 person/Rp 150,000, 2 people Rp 300,000 per night including a pick up at Masbagik district. 3 meals per day per person is Rp 100,000 extra.
